Output 94197835477feea820df9d6578937a84ed2fcf26e7e1356b6016035e366b5e57:14

value
559763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c89a6e837a7aa99a01dcc731c57a48ba42d1f27 OP_EQUAL
address
3LLWfuQrwqp8oimxhgrNLtQ4R3oeVptUR4
transaction
94197835477feea820df9d6578937a84ed2fcf26e7e1356b6016035e366b5e57
spent
true